carlton’s Contract Conundrum: ‍Curnow,McKay,and Walsh Futures Uncertain Amidst Club-Wide Reassessment

Carlton ⁤faces a meaningful contract crossroads as speculation mounts over the futures of ⁣its star trio: Charlie Curnow,Harry McKay,and Sam Walsh. With over 15 players out of contract at the end ‍of the⁤ season, the club is reportedly undergoing a broad⁣ reassessment, prompting senior players ⁢to seek clarity from football boss Graham Wright.

“At ⁣Least One Won’t Be There Next Year”: Inside ⁣Carlton’s Contract Drama

The pressure is mounting at ‍Ikon Park, with insiders suggesting a significant shake-up is on the horizon. Midweek⁣ tackle ⁣panellist Corbin Middlemas revealed, “I spoke to people close to this today and essentially⁣ their feeling is at least one of them (Curnow, McKay or ⁤Walsh) won’t be there next year.” This stark ⁣prediction‍ underscores the⁣ urgency of the contract situation for the⁤ Blues.

the club’s football director, Graham Wright, is reportedly facing a tight financial⁢ situation, with limited flexibility in managing the salary‍ cap. However, the potential departure⁣ of a key player could open up much-needed breathing room. Adding to⁤ the uncertainty, Middlemas also disclosed that “there⁢ have been at least half a dozen players meet with Graham Wright in recent ‍weeks basically to search⁢ a ⁣direction for ⁤the club.” ⁣This ‍proactive approach from⁣ senior players indicates a desire to understand their roles and the club’s trajectory, especially following comments from the club ⁢president about a post-season review.

A Club-Wide Reassessment: Senior Players Seek Direction

The sentiment among the playing group appears to be one of seeking clarity and control ‍over their futures. As the home-and-away season draws to⁣ a close, the looming contract deadlines have spurred many senior players to engage directly with management. These ‍meetings⁢ with Graham Wright are crucial for players to “work out exactly what it looks like moving forward,” ensuring ⁣they are aligned with the club’s vision or exploring alternative options if necessary.

The impending departure of Carlton veteran Sam Docherty, who announced his retirement after thursday’s clash with Hawthorn, marks the end of an era for the ‍club and highlights the natural ‍cycle of player careers. Though,with over 15 players still needing new deals,the focus remains firmly on the future of Carlton’s current stars and the⁣ strategic decisions that will shape the club for seasons ‍to come.
